Javascript “如何修复”;无法读取属性';createDocumentFragment'&引用;

Javascript “如何修复”;无法读取属性';createDocumentFragment'&引用;,javascript,matrix,Javascript,Matrix,我在代码中遇到了一个无法解决的问题。 我得到以下错误: 无法读取未定义的-jquery-3.3.1.min.js的属性“createDocumentFragment”:2 这是我的密码: $.ajax({ url: '/ajax/getPvaSession.php' }).done(function (data) { let content = data['content']; console.log(content);

我在代码中遇到了一个无法解决的问题。 我得到以下错误:

无法读取未定义的-jquery-3.3.1.min.js的属性“createDocumentFragment”:2

这是我的密码:

   $.ajax({
        url: '/ajax/getPvaSession.php'
    }).done(function (data) {
        let content = data['content'];
        console.log(content);
        $('body').append('<table id="table"></table>');
        for (let i=0;i<content[i].length;++i) {
            $('table').append('<tr id="' + i + '"></tr>');
            for (let j=0; j<content.length; ++j){
                $(i).append('<td id="' + i + '_' + j + '">' + content[i][j] + '</td>')
            }
        }
    })
我在网上读到,很多人用
this
错误的方式面对这个错误,但我没有在任何地方使用它

你能澄清一下吗?如果可能的话,解释一下错误,这样下次我就不会犯错误了。
谢谢

您需要作为
content.length
而不是
content[0].length循环通过外部数组。并在内部数组中使用
content[0].length

比如:

“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“”、“1”、“”、“1”、“1”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”、、、、、、、、、、、、、、、、、、、、,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,],[“疾病”、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、]] $('body')。追加(''); 对于(设i=0;i
td{
边框:1px实心#dddddd;
}

您需要作为
content.length
而不是
content[0]。length
。在外部数组中循环,并在内部数组中使用
content[0]。length

比如:

“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“1”、“1”、“”、“1”、“1”、“1”、“1”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“”、“1”、“”、“1”、“1”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“”、“”、“”、“1”、“”、“”、“”、“”、“”、“”、“1”、“1”、“”、“”、“”、“”、“,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”,”、、、、、、、、、、、、、、、、、、、、,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,,],[“疾病”、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、、]] $('body')。追加(''); 对于(设i=0;i
td{
边框:1px实心#dddddd;
}

可能您的追加工作不正常?如果是,请尝试使用var table=document.createElement('table')创建元素,添加id属性,然后在body上执行appendChild(table)(对于要追加的所有元素都相同)可能您的追加工作不正常?如果是,请尝试使用var table=document.createElement创建元素('table'),添加id属性,然后在body上执行appendChild(table)(对于要追加的所有元素都相同)
(8) [Array(31), Array(31), Array(31), Array(31), Array(31), Array(31), Array(31), Array(31)]
0: (31) ["Projet", "1", "2", "3", "4", "5", "6", "7", "8", "9", "10", "11", "12", "13", "14", "15", "16", "17", "18", "19", "20", "21", "22", "23", "24", "25", "26", "27", "28", "29", "30"]
1: (31) ["Administrateur Réseau", "1", "1", "1", "1", "1", "", "", "1", "1", "0.5", "", "", "", "", "1", "1", "1", "1", "1", "", "", "", "1", "1", "1", "1", "", "", "1", "1"]
2: (31) ["Intercontrat", "", "", "", "", "", "", "", "", "", "0.5",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
3: (31) ["Formation",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
4: (31) ["Congés payés",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
5: (31) ["Congés sans solde",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
6: (31) ["Incentive",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
7: (31) ["Maladie",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", "", ""]
length: 8